About Sanatorium

Sanatorium matters for its unflinching exploration of the darkest corners of human experience, carving a niche in the brutal death metal landscape that challenges listeners to confront their own discomfort.

Their sound resonates with an intensity that pulls from primal instincts and existential dread, creating a visceral atmosphere that encourages communal catharsis in live settings, where audience engagement becomes an essential part of the experience. The band approaches their craft with a relentless commitment to rawness and authenticity, employing dissonant riffs and guttural vocals that not only showcase technical prowess but also evoke a sense of chaos and urgency. This fierce dedication to pushing sonic limits fosters an environment where listeners can immerse themselves completely, surrendering to the overwhelming force of sound that Sanatorium conjures. Lyrically, they often delve into themes of despair, mortality, and the macabre, employing a brutally honest voice that balances sincerity with an unsettling irony. Their storytelling tends to be direct yet impressionistic, painting vivid images that linger long after the music has ended, inviting reflection on the darker aspects of existence.
